At Montessori Reggio Academy, we are dedicated to nurturing the curiosity, independence, and confidence of our youngest learners. Our Transitional Primary program lays a strong foundation for lifelong learning by blending the Montessori philosophy, Reggio Emilia principles, and the Cambridge International Early Years curriculum. Through a carefully prepared environment and child-centered approach, we foster self-paced, self-led exploration while ensuring each child receives the guidance and support needed to thrive.
Our students engage in hands-on, inquiry-based learning experiences, working both independently and in small groups. Under the guidance of our highly trained Montessori teachers, children develop essential early academic and social-emotional skills. The classroom environment is thoughtfully designed with natural lighting, calming colors, and organized materials to encourage focus and creativity.
The Reggio Emilia approach enhances our curriculum by embracing children as active participants in their learning journey. We encourage students to ask questions, share ideas, and express themselves freely, helping them build confidence and communication skills. Each month, our students explore Reggio-inspired themes and projects, deepening their understanding through hands-on, creative experiences.
